Over half of the world’s population now lives in cities, making efficient movement a critical challenge. Urban mobility encompasses the systems and services—from public transit and bike-sharing to pedestrian pathways and ride-hailing apps—that enable people to navigate dense areas. Its primary benefit is reducing reliance on private cars, which cuts congestion and pollution while freeing up public space. To use it, one simply chooses the smartest combination of available modes for any given trip, such as walking, cycling, or using on-demand shuttles.

Defining the Term: Moving Beyond Just Cars and Buses

To truly grasp urban mobility, you must move beyond just cars and buses and consider the entire ecosystem of movement at your disposal. This definition folds in micro-mobility options like e-scooters for a quick café run, bike-share for errands, and walking for the most direct local trips. It also includes ride-hailing, car-share for occasional hauling, and integrated transit apps that merge train schedules with your last-mile scooter. Your daily life is not one mode; it’s a fluid mix of these choices, each suited to a specific distance, budget, or time constraint.

Choosing the Right Way to Get Around Your City

Choosing the right way to get around your city boils down to matching speed, cost, and stress. For short trips under two miles, walking or a shared scooter beats waiting for a bus. When you need reliability, public transit often wins because dedicated lanes ignore gridlock, while biking fills the gap for medium distances where parking is a nightmare.

Your best mode changes with the hour: a bike-share at 10am might be perfect, but rain or rush hour demands a train or subway.

For longer journeys or carrying heavy bags, ride-hailing or a car-share vehicle makes sense, but only if you’re okay with surge pricing. The trick is having a few backup options saved in your phone’s apps.

Practical Tips for Using Shared Vehicles and Services

For efficient urban mobility, always inspect a shared vehicle for damage before unlocking it and photograph any existing issues within the app. To avoid surge pricing and find available rides, check multiple dockless bike or scooter apps briefly before starting your trip. When returning the vehicle, park it in designated corrals or clear sidewalk zones to prevent fines for both yourself and the service. For car-sharing, plan your parking zone in advance, as some services require return to a specific spot while others allow free-floating drop-offs within a home area. Keeping a portable charger ensures your phone remains powered to complete trips and report problems, directly supporting seamless shared mobility management in urban environments.

Finding and Unlocking Bikes, Scooters, or E-Mopeds Near You

urban mobility

To locate a nearby vehicle, open the mobility app and use its map view, which shows available bikes, scooters, or e-mopeds as icons. Tap an icon to see its battery level and estimated cost. For unlocking, scan the QR code on the handlebar or deck, or enter the vehicle’s ID number into the app. Finding and unlocking bikes or scooters near you typically requires Bluetooth to be active for a secure connection. Some services require you to pre-purchase a ride pass before the unlock button becomes active, so check your wallet first.

  • Always verify the vehicle’s battery percentage on the map before walking to it.
  • If the QR code is damaged, use the manual entry option for the vehicle ID.
  • Ensure your phone has a stable internet connection, as unlocking fails without one.
  • After scanning, wait for a confirmation sound or vibration before lifting the kickstand.

Parking Rules and Ending Your Rental Correctly

Ending your rental correctly requires strict adherence to designated parking zones within the app’s map. To avoid penalties, always verify the vehicle is inside a permitted area before ending the trip. The most critical step is confirming a valid parking spot through the service’s photo verification. Follow this sequence:

  1. Park only in geofenced or marked spots shown in the app.
  2. Take a clear photo showing the vehicle is not obstructing traffic or private driveways.
  3. Manually lock the vehicle and check for an “end trip” confirmation notification.

Skipping these steps risks fines for improper termination, undermining the convenience of shared urban mobility.

Safety Guidelines for Riding in Mixed Traffic

urban mobility

When navigating mixed traffic, **defensive positioning is critical** for visibility; always ride in the lane’s center at intersections to avoid being squeezed by turning vehicles. Scan for opening car doors and erratic pedestrian movements, maintaining a two-second following distance from cars. Your most powerful safety tool is proactive eye contact with drivers at every turn. Signal your intentions early with hand gestures and avoid riding in blind spots.

  • Claim your full lane at slow speeds to prevent unsafe passes.
  • Use a bright headlight and bell, even during daylight hours.
  • Anticipate drivers turning right across your path at junctions.

How to Handle Unexpected Problems Like Dead Batteries or Locked Docks

When encountering a dead battery or locked dock, first check the app for nearby available vehicles or docks with open bays. If a battery dies mid-trip, lock the scooter or bike at a legal parking spot and report it via the app to avoid penalty. For a locked dock, use the app to locate the nearest station with capacity or request an unlocking override if the dock is mislabeled. Maintaining a backup payment method ensures you can quickly unlock an alternative vehicle without delay.

Understanding Coverage Zones and Where You Cannot Go

Before you zip off, **know your no-go zones**. Apps clearly outline coverage edges, often fading near highways, parks, or private complexes. Drops in service mean the e-scooter or bike may power down, leaving you stranded. Geo-fencing boundaries also prohibit parking on sidewalks or blocking doorways; fines apply. Always check the live map before trips.

Q: What happens if I ride past the coverage zone? A: The vehicle will gradually lose power, then lock. You must push it back inside, incurring an idle fee until returned.
